이 문서에서는 C# REST API를 사용하여 Excel에서 이미지 배경을 제거하는 방법을 안내합니다. .NET 기반 클라우드 SDK를 사용하여 C# REST 인터페이스를 사용하여 Excel에서 그림 배경을 제거하는 방법을 배우게 됩니다. 또한 개별 워크시트에서 배경을 제거하는 데에도 도움이 됩니다.
필수 조건
- 배경 이미지 삭제를 위한 계정을 생성하고 API 자격 증명을 받으세요
- 배경 이미지를 제거하려면 Dotnet용 Aspose.Cells Cloud SDK을 다운로드하세요.
- 위 SDK를 사용하여 C# 프로젝트를 설정하세요
C# REST 인터페이스를 사용하여 Excel에서 그림 배경을 제거하는 단계
- 클라이언트 ID, 클라이언트 비밀번호 및 Aspose Cloud 기반 URL을 사용하여 CellsApi 객체를 설정합니다.
- 대상 Excel 파일을 열고 Aspose Cloud 저장소에 업로드하기 위한 UploadFileRequest를 생성합니다.
- CellsApi 클래스의 UploadFile() 메서드를 사용하여 클라우드에 업로드 요청을 보냅니다.
- 파일 이름과 기본 저장소/폴더 설정을 사용하여 DeleteWorkbookBackgroundRequest 객체를 구성합니다.
- 통합 문서의 배경을 제거하기 위한 준비된 요청으로 DeleteWorkbookBackground()을 호출합니다.
- DownloadFileRequest 및 DownloadFile()을 사용하여 클라우드에서 수정된 Excel 파일을 검색합니다.
- FileStream을 사용하여 다운로드한 스트림을 새 로컬 파일에 씁니다.
이 단계에서는 C# RESTful 서비스를 사용하여 Excel에서 이미지 배경을 제거하는 방법을 간략하게 설명합니다. 이 과정은 API 자격 증명을 사용하여 Aspose.Cells Cloud에 연결하고, Excel 파일을 업로드한 후, 전용 API 요청을 사용하여 배경을 제거합니다. 배경이 제거되면 업데이트된 파일이 다운로드되어 로컬에 저장됩니다.
C# REST API를 사용하여 Excel에서 이미지 배경을 제거하는 코드
위 코드는 C# .NET 기반 API를 사용하여 Excel에서 사진 배경을 제거하는 방법을 보여줍니다. 이 코드는 전체 통합 문서에서 배경 이미지를 제거합니다. 단일 시트 또는 선택한 시트의 배경을 제거하려면 시트 이름을 사용하여 배경 그림을 제거하는 DeleteWorksheetBackground() 메서드를 사용할 수 있습니다.
이 문서에서는 Excel 파일에서 배경 이미지를 제거하는 방법을 설명했습니다. Excel 파일에 배경 이미지를 삽입하려면 C# REST API를 사용하여 Excel에 배경 이미지 삽입 문서를 참조하세요.